As mentioned above, at initially units and audio system from house audio techniques and professional markets have been just simply installed into vehicles. On the other hand, they were not nicely suited towards the extremes of temperature and vibration which are a normal part of your surroundings of an automobile. Auto stereo enthusiasts weren’t satisfied using the sound high quality of regular car or truck sound techniques, and with the advent from the CD player, they genuinely had to begin modifying some of these property stereos in order to work effectively in a vehicle environment and voila!, now we have the modern car stereo.  Â
If you’ve got a new vehicle, 1st hand bought, say from about 90 to present, chances are you currently have a “factory†automobile stereo inside your car. It means the vehicle producer currently integrated a car stereo method within your vehicle, unless specified in the vehicle model but most frequently this is the case. Some car or truck manufacturers make their own car or truck stereos, like BMW which incorporates a fairly decent automobile stereo package head unit and speakers. It is actually a regular which comes with all their automobiles (which isn’t surprising thinking about that BMW is incorporated in the league of “luxury auto manufacturersâ€)! Or like Mercedes Benz or Volkswagen, they use car or truck stereo methods from a German audio producer referred to as Blaupunkt.
A standard car stereo (also called a head unit) generally incorporates an auto-reverse tape deck, a cd player and sometimes the optional changer – a device which automatically changes the cd in play. On newer car models, the auto stereo can also play mp3s and other digital audo file kinds like WMA and AAC, whether or not on a cd or a memory device which can be hooked up towards the head unit.
The vehicle stereo head unit is connected to numerous speakers. Older auto models commonly just had 1 speaker mounted underneath the dashboard, pointing by means of perforations towards the front windshield. The normal for auto stereo these days can be a pair of “tweeters†(used to bring out high treble) on the driver side/front passenger aspect dashboard, a pair of usual “mid†audio system on both doors, sometimes even the backseat passeger doors if it is a large vehicle and larger speakers capable of bringing out low ends at the back protion of the backseats.
Your car or truck stereo is most likely ok as it is, as automobile manufacturers ensure that the audio products that come with their autos can handle most dirver’s listening demands. But in the event you think that what you’ve isn’t sufficient, you can usually CUSTOMIZE.    Â
